The DVB Sync Source is a high performance, flexible and highly reliable
timing system designed for Single
Frequency Network (SFN) synchronization for Digital Video
Broadcasting (DVB) and Digital Audio Broadcasting (DAB) applications.

DVB/DAB require a precision time and frequency reference to synchronize
transmitters across multiple locations. Without synchronization,
networks are not able to deliver reliable video and audio content to the
end user. The 4370A receives reference-timing signals from Global
Positioning System (GPS) and translates them to generate the output
signals. In case of GPS loss, the 4370A, when configured with redundant
timing inputs will automatically switch to an auxiliary input to
continually provide outputs that are traceable to a primary reference
clock. Redundancy is a key requirement because without GPS based sync,
transmission is lost and Quality of Service (QoS) is degraded.

About Symmetricom, Inc.
As a worldwide leader in precise time and frequency products and
services, Symmetricom provides “Perfect Timing”
to customers around the world. Since 1985, the company’s
solutions have helped define the world’s time
and frequency standards, delivering precision, reliability and
efficiency to wireline and wireless networks, instrumentation and
testing applications and network time management. Deployed in more than
90 countries, the company’s synchronization
solutions include primary reference sources, building integrated timing
supplies (BITS), GPS timing receivers, time and frequency distribution
systems, network time servers and ruggedized oscillators. Symmetricom
also incorporates technologies including Universal Timing Interface
(UTI), Network
Time Protocol (NTP),
Precision Time Protocol (IEEE 1588), and others supporting the world’s
migration to Next Generation Networks (NGN). Symmetricom is based in San
Jose, Calif., with offices worldwide. For more information, visit www.symmetricom.com.
